#6DB5C5 Hex color

#6DB5C5

The hexadecimal color code #6DB5C5 corresponds to the code RGB( 109, 181, 197 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,43 level), green (at 0,71 level) and blue (at 0,77 level). Its brightness is 60% and its saturation is 43%. It is composed of red at 22%, green at 37% and blue at 40%.
